CLASSIC CLUB
TENTH MEETING A programino of "nature music" was presented at the Classic Club's 10th meeting of the present season, held in the Overseas League rooms on Tuesday evening. A short talk on "Illustration in Music" was given by the president, Dr. S. Kenneth Phillips, who described the various methods used by composers in giving pictorial effects to their come positions. Members who contributed items were: —Miss Thora Davidson, Miss Olive Ball, Miss Kay Christie and Mr. Jamos Ramsay, who sang; and Mrs. Maud Lysaght and Mrs. Sholto Smith, who played pianoforte solos. The accompanists were Airs. Lysaght, Mr. Alan row and Dr. S. K. Phillips.
